*Duties*:

*Substance Abuse Counselor* *-* The healthcare worker shall provide services within the scope of their competencies, the applicable duties provided in the basic contract, and the following:

Perform a full range of Certified Addiction Counselor duties, in accordance with assignment and consistent with the scope of practice for profession, including but not limited to, medical care treatment and patient education in a knowledgeable, skillful, consistent, and continuous manner.

Obtain or provide relevant information that will facilitate treatment and assist in developing programs.

Provide assessment of substance abuse and addiction.

Identify and document medical consequences of alcohol and other substance use, including withdrawal and detoxification.

Facilitate the placement and management of patients in appropriate levels of care within the continuum of care model of the treatment of addictive disorders
